Litecoin BEP20 LTC

Introduction to Litecoin BEP20 (LTC) on the Binance Smart Chain

Litecoin BEP20 LTC represents an innovative integration of the well-established Litecoin (LTC) digital currency into the Binance Smart Chain (BSC) ecosystem. By leveraging the BEP20 token standard, LTC holders can enjoy seamless interaction within DeFi applications, decentralized exchanges, and cross-chain functionalities. This development signals a new chapter for Litecoin, transforming it into a versatile asset fit for modern blockchain use cases.

Unique Selling Proposition (USP)

The primary USP of Litecoin BEP20 LTC is its ability to combine Litecoin’s resilience, security, and widespread acceptance with the versatility and speed of the Binance Smart Chain. This allows users to manage LTC within a decentralized environment, tap into DeFi protocols, and benefit from low transaction fees. Unlike traditional LTC transactions, which are limited to the Litecoin network, BEP20 LTC offers interoperability, enabling movement across multiple platforms seamlessly.

Target Audience

The primary targets for Litecoin BEP20 LTC include:

  • Crypto enthusiasts and investors looking to diversify their portfolios seeking exposure to Litecoin’s value within DeFi ecosystems.
  • DeFi users and traders who desire fast, low-cost transactions, and liquidity options.
  • Blockchain developers and startups aiming to build applications that integrate Litecoin's stability with the capabilities of the Binance Smart Chain.
  • Crypto traders interested in arbitrage opportunities between traditional LTC markets and their BEP20 counterparts.

Overall, tech-savvy users, DeFi adopters, and those focusing on cross-chain assets form the core audience.

Market Competition and Positioning

The cryptocurrency landscape for Litecoin BEP20 LTC is competitive, with several similar offerings circulating. Notable competitors include wrapped versions of LTC on Ethereum (such as WLitecoin), and other Binance Smart Chain tokens tied to different assets. The key differentiator for LTC BEP20 is its native integration with the Binance Smart Chain, renowned for fast transaction speeds and low fees.

While Ethereum-based wrapped LTC often face higher gas fees and congestion, LTC BEP20 benefits from BSC’s efficiency, making it more accessible to everyday users. Its strategic positioning emphasizes interoperability, low-cost transactions, and high liquidity, aiming to attract both LTC holders and DeFi users.

Perception and Market Sentiment

While Litecoin remains a respected and established brand, the new BEP20 version is viewed with cautious optimism by the community. Enthusiasts appreciate the convenience and expanding use cases, but some remain skeptical about the underlying security and decentralization of exchanges bridging LTC into BEP20 form.

Perception is also influenced by the broader DeFi hype, which can sometimes overshadow the foundational value of the asset. Nonetheless, the integration is seen as a positive step toward modernizing Litecoin's utility and encouraging adoption in the decentralized finance space.

Advantages of Litecoin BEP20 LTC

  • Low Transaction Costs: BSC’s efficient infrastructure drastically reduces fees compared to Ethereum-based assets.
  • Fast Transactions: Within seconds, users can send and receive LTC BEP20 tokens, enhancing usability.
  • Interoperability: LTC can be seamlessly used across multiple DApps, loan platforms, and decentralized exchanges.
  • Liquidity and Accessibility: Listed on numerous BSC-based platforms, enabling easier trading and liquidity pools.
  • Enhanced Use Cases: Participation in yield farming, staking, and liquidity provision becomes straightforward.
  • Boosted Adoption: Bridging Litecoin to a thriving DeFi ecosystem encourages more mainstream usage.

Risks and Challenges

Despite its advantages, Litecoin BEP20 LTC faces specific risks:

  • Security Concerns: As a wrapper token, it depends heavily on the security of the bridging mechanism and smart contracts, which could be vulnerable to exploits.
  • Market Volatility: DeFi tokens are susceptible to high volatility, impacting liquidity and trading stability.
  • Centralization Risks: Some bridging solutions involve centralized exchanges, which can undermine decentralization principles.
  • Regulatory Uncertainty: Evolving crypto regulations may affect cross-chain tokens and their future usage.
  • Community Skepticism: Resistance from purists who prefer native assets over wrapped or tokenized versions.

Use Cases and Practical Applications

Litecoin BEP20 LTC supports a diverse range of practical applications:

  • Decentralized Trading: Use in Binance Smart Chain DEXs like PancakeSwap for trading against other tokens.
  • Staking and Yield Farming: Earning passive income through liquidity pools or staking LTC BEP20 tokens.
  • Cross-Chain Arbitrage: Exploiting price differences between LTC on the Litecoin network and its BEP20 version on BSC.
  • DeFi Collateral: Using LTC BEP20 as collateral in borrowing and lending protocols.
  • Payment Solution: Accepting Litecoin in DeFi-enabled merchant applications.
  • Portfolio Diversification: Having exposure to Litecoin’s price movements within decentralized ecosystems.

Future Outlook and Prospects

The outlook for Litecoin BEP20 LTC remains promising, driven by broader trends of interoperability and DeFi adoption. As blockchain technology matures, the potential for cross-chain bridges and more secure token standards will enhance trust and usability.

Potential collaborations, increased liquidity pools, and expanding user bases can elevate LTC’s presence in decentralized finance. Furthermore, ongoing advancements in security, scalability, and regulatory clarity will shape its future trajectory. With strong community backing and strategic partnerships, Litecoin BEP20 LTC can evolve into a significant component of the DeFi ecosystem, extending Litecoin’s legacy into the decentralized future.


EOS EOS

Understanding EOS EOS: An Overview

EOS EOS stands out as a pioneering blockchain platform designed for high scalability and user-friendly decentralized applications. Built to address the limitations of earlier blockchain solutions, EOS offers developers a robust environment that balances speed, security, and flexibility. Its unique consensus mechanism and innovative architecture have positioned EOS as a formidable contender in the crowded blockchain ecosystem.

Unique Selling Proposition (USP) of EOS EOS

The primary USP of EOS EOS is its high-performance blockchain infrastructure that supports rapid transaction speeds with minimal fees. Unlike traditional blockchain platforms, EOS leverages Delegated Proof-of-Stake (DPoS) consensus, enabling scalability to thousands of transactions per second. Additionally, EOS provides a develop-friendly environment with an intuitive coding language (C++), comprehensive developer tools, and built-in features such as smart contract deployment, user account management, and inter-blockchain communication. This combination ensures that both developers and enterprises can deploy and manage decentralized apps seamlessly.

Target Audience of EOS EOS

The platform's core users include blockchain developers, startups, and established enterprises seeking high-throughput DApps. It also appeals to investors looking for innovative blockchain projects with real-world applications, and to tech-savvy businesses aiming to harness blockchain for supply chain, finance, gaming, and IoT solutions. Furthermore, EOS’s user-centric design attracts entrepreneurs interested in launching decentralized platforms that require fast, scalable, and cost-effective blockchain infrastructure.

Competition in the Blockchain Arena

In the rapidly evolving blockchain sector, EOS EOS faces competition from platforms like Ethereum 2.0, Binance Smart Chain, Solana, and Cardano. While Ethereum remains the dominant presence with the largest ecosystem, EOS differentiates itself via faster transaction speeds, lower costs, and a more scalable architecture. However, it must contend with ongoing debates about decentralization and governance, which are also concerns for other competing platforms. EOS's focus on enterprise adoption and high-performance DApps gives it a competitive edge, yet challenges around network security and community decentralization persist.

Public Perception and Brand Image

EOS EOS is often viewed as an innovative but somewhat controversial project. Its high-performance features are widely appreciated among developers and users seeking efficiency, but critics point to questions about decentralization, governance transparency, and security. Despite this, EOS has built a loyal community and maintains a strong presence in the blockchain industry. Its corporate backing, active development community, and a growing number of live applications bolster its positive perception as a scalable and developer-friendly platform.

Advantages of EOS EOS

  • High Transaction Throughput: Capable of processing thousands of transactions per second, ensuring smooth user experience.
  • No Transaction Fees: Employs flexible resource allocation, eliminating typical blockchain fees for users.
  • Developer-Friendly Ecosystem: Offers C++ based smart contracts, detailed SDKs, and extensive documentation.
  • Inter-Blockchain Communication: Facilitates seamless data exchange between various blockchains.
  • Scalable Blockchain Infrastructure: Designed to support enterprise-level DApps and complex ecosystems.

Potential Risks and Challenges

Despite its advantages, EOS EOS faces several risks. The debate over decentralization remains a key concern, as its DPoS consensus places significant power in the hands of a limited number of block producers. This could pose centralization risks if not managed properly. Additionally, the platform’s security is an ongoing area of scrutiny, especially when considering high-stakes enterprise applications. Market volatility, regulatory uncertainty, and fierce competition also represent significant risks that could influence the long-term viability of EOS projects.

Use Cases and Practical Applications

EOS EOS is already powering a diverse array of applications, including:

  • Decentralized Applications (DApps): from gaming to social media, leveraging EOS’s scalability
  • Supply Chain Solutions: enabling transparent and tamper-proof tracking of goods and inventory
  • Financial Services: facilitating token issuance, decentralized finance (DeFi), and cross-border payments
  • IoT Integration: supporting secure and scalable data exchanges among connected devices

As the ecosystem matures, new use cases are expected to emerge, driven by the platform’s fast, cost-effective, and scalable architecture.

Future Prospects of EOS EOS

The prospects for EOS EOS are promising, particularly if it continues to enhance network decentralization, security, and user adoption. Its strategic focus on enterprise solutions and interoperability positions it well in the evolving blockchain landscape. Moreover, ongoing community engagement, technological upgrades, and partnerships will be crucial in maintaining its competitive edge. As blockchain applications become more mainstream, EOS’s infrastructure could become foundational for many high-volume, enterprise-grade DApps and services. However, it must navigate regulatory challenges and societal perceptions to realize its full potential.
